The Rise Of Digital Gold Trading Platforms And What They Offer
Digital gold trading platforms are growing because they match modern habits. People like clear information, quick access, and the comfort of checking their holdings at any time.
Easy Access Has Changed The Way People View Gold
One of the main things these platforms offer is convenience. A person can open an account, view live prices, and buy small or large amounts in a short time. This makes gold feel more open to people who want flexibility in how they build their savings. It also allows users to start at a level that feels comfortable instead of waiting until they can make a large purchase.
Another reason these platforms are getting attention is price visibility. Many users appreciate being able to see current rates directly on screen. This helps make the process feel more open and simple. People can read details, compare options, and make decisions at their own pace. That sense of clarity is one of the biggest reasons digital gold has become part of modern financial conversation.
Some platforms also give users a smooth way to monitor their activity over time. They can check purchase history, review current value, and plan future steps without dealing with paper records. In many cases, the full process feels more organised and easier to follow. What Users Value Most On Modern Platforms
A strong digital gold platform usually offers a mix of simplicity and useful information. Users often look for easy account setup, live pricing, smooth payment methods, and access to support when needed. These features help remove confusion and make the process feel more natural, even for first-time users. When information is presented in plain language, people feel more relaxed and more confident about what they are doing.
Another useful part is flexibility. Some people want to buy small amounts on a regular basis. Others prefer to watch prices first and act later. Digital platforms support both styles. This makes gold feel less distant and more practical for different kinds of users. Instead of one fixed way to take part, people can choose a pace that suits their routine, comfort level, and financial goals.
There is also an educational side to these platforms. Many now include articles, FAQs, price charts, and short explainers that help users build knowledge over time. That matters because people usually make better choices when they understand the basics. A simple explanation of how pricing works, how storage is handled, or how redemption works can make the whole experience easier to trust and easier to use.
